Recall, just this week Nokia announced the availability of the new, N97 to the US market (as well as many other Global markets). Recall, this device comes with 32 gigabytes of internal memory with a microSD card slot for additional memory (up to 16 gigabytes), an nHD display with 16:9 true widescreen resolution, five megapixel camera with Carl Zeiss Optics and dual LED flash – making this the only device to carry for one’s daily needs. A-GPS and a full HTML web browser with Adobe Flash support rounds out the features of this powerful mobile computer. Enjoy the video below to give you a better look at this sweet device!

Mapping State and National Parks with Accuterra for iPhone
An interesting new mobile mapping product this week from Intermap Technologies in the new Accuterra maps for iPhone – think mobile topos (and more) for State and Federal Parks. Just this week Intermap Technologies’ AccuTerra product won the award for “Best iPhone OS 3.0 Beta App”! Some details… Key to remember about AccuTerra is the 3D component meaning that elevation is provided, something which is essential information for anyone trekking about – whether they’re hiking in Rocky Mountain National Park or climbing in Yosemite. And again, this technology plots and tracks your progress on your iPhone even when you’re out of cell range. The app also provides a social link enabling users to create virtual walking tours of their adventures with annotations and the ability share their routes complete with geo-tagged photos with friends via email and social networks like Facebook.
